Mike, I use Gentoo too (2) ;-) I can't get Midgard 1.6.1 or 1.6.2 to run with Apache 2.0.5x when it is using the threaded model (do 'apache2 -l' and look for worker.c to verify [if it shows prefork.c instead then you are good to go]). If you change your USE flags and re-build apache (there's a specific mpm_prefork flag that will set that up.
midgard-apache2 module is mostly midgard-apache1 module with some changes which allow this module to be usefull. That's why this module works only with prefork model.
Piotras, is there a known problem with Apache2 threaded and Midgard or am I missing something?
See above. No one ever wrote any code for threaded model of Apache2. Debian's perchild and threadpool models are described as experimental, so I even do not think about thinking about this :)
